Le Bar Américain at Hôtel de Paris Monte Carlo

Le Bar Americain in Monte Carlo is a beloved destination, where amber hues and a striking verre églomisé back bar create a timeless atmosphere. With its classic design and glamorous charm, the bar offers an unforgettable setting for sophisticated cocktails and conversation.

Le Bar Américain unveiled its new look in the summer of 2018, sensitively revived by David Collins Studio to retain the glamour and charm for which it is known. Polished wood and burnished leather armchairs accompany deep-pile rugs and soft lighting to create a scheme that changes mood depending on the time of day. The bar really comes into its own after dark, when decadent cocktails and live jazz music bring a 1920s-era vibe.

Situated within the legendary Hôtel de Paris in Monte Carlo, Le Bar Américain has been refashioned to capture its historic elegance while introducing a contemporary sensibility. Commissioned by Monte Carlo Société des Bains de Mer, the interiors honour the venue’s rich heritage through an enhanced sense of luxury, texture, and charm.

Walls are lined with amber raw silk with burgundy gimp trim, framed elegantly in rosewood, creating a warm and enveloping backdrop. The overall colour palette of amber and rosewood glows, enhancing the inviting and timeless atmosphere. Bespoke leather furniture, including the iconic bar seating, in tones complementing the walls enhances the design, while a marble mosaic floor and deep-pile carpets contribute to the bar’s tactile richness. The intricate interplay of materials—wood, leather, and marble—ensures the space feels enduringly refined. Soft, warm lighting allows the atmosphere to transition seamlessly from a glamorous daytime lounge to a seductive evening retreat.

The bar itself is a masterpiece of craftsmanship, featuring timber marquetry and bespoke detailing that reflects the venue’s unique personality. A memorable brass horse head table lamp adds a whimsical touch to the design. Behind the bar, églomisé mirrors evoke vintage Monaco Grand Prix illustrations, adding a layer of nostalgia and glamour. A live music stage and terrace seating harmonise within the room’s layout, ensuring every seat offers a privileged view of the entertainment and surroundings. The terrace offers stunning vistas of the sea, the Casino, and Place du Casino, further elevating the guest experience.

Artful details, including stitched lighting fixtures and embossed leather finishes, add layers of refinement to the space, reinforcing its status as an icon of understated luxury. The addition of a humidor provides an exclusive touch, allowing prestigious guests the privilege of personalised cigar storage.

Le Bar Américain celebrates its heritage through a meticulous reinterpretation of its signature features, creating a timeless yet vibrant destination where the past and future harmoniously converge.
